ʻauhea 1. inter. Where (in questions). 2. idiom. listen (in commands, common in songs). PNP fea. 3. idiom. Sir [formal beginning of a letter]. |
( 14 )
| 1. | ʻauhea akula nāhi keiki? | Where are the boys? | nāhi₁ |
| 2. | ʻauhea hoʻi ka hele mai o lākou e kōkua. | They'll never come and help, they don't care. | ʻauhea hoʻi |
| 3. | ʻauhea kahi e hele ai? | Where's the place to go? | kahi₃ |
| 4. | ʻauhea kahi o Kupa mā? | Where's the residence of Kupa and his family? | kahi₃ |
| 5. | ʻauhea kuʻu ʻekeʻeke paʻa lima? | Where is my handbag? | paʻa lima |
| 6. | ʻauhea ʻoe, ē ke kanaka o ke akua, eia kā kāua wahi ʻai, ua loaʻa maila mai ka pō mai ka pō mai; no laila nāu e ʻaumakua mai i ka ʻai a kāua. | Hearken, O man who serves the god, here is food for you [lit.., our food], received from the night, so bless our food in the name of the | ʻaumakua₂ |

| 8. | ʻauhea ʻoukou! | Hear ye! | ʻauhea₂ |
| 9. | ʻauhea wale ana ʻoe, ē ka pua o ka loke lani. | Now pay attention, O blossom of the rose. | ʻauhea₂ |
| 10. | ʻauhea wale ʻoe, ē ka manu ʻōʻū ʻoe o ka nahele. | Listen, O bird, you honey creeper of the forest. | ʻōʻū₃ |
| 11. | ʻauhea wale ʻoe, ē ke ānuenue e lalaʻi maila i Haleola. | Hearken to me, O rainbow, so serene at Haleola. | lalaʻi |
| 12. | ʻauhea wale ʻoe, ē ke kualau, ka ua nū hele ma ka moana. | Listen, o kualau shower, rain moaning over the open sea. | kualau |
| 13. | I make nō he hāwāwā, ʻauhea nohoʻi nā lima e ʻau mai? | The unskilled die, where are arms to swim with? [Skill saves life.] | hāwāwā |
| 14. | Kīpū i ka manaʻo, kīpū i ke kapa a ka noe; ʻauhea wale ʻoe ē ka ʻohu, kīpū maila i Kaʻala. | Hold fast to an idea, hold fast to the tapa blanket of mist; listen here, O mist, nestling now on [Mt.] Kaʻala. | kīpū₁ |
